SECTION 4
P
ROGRAMMING
S
YSTEM DATA
This section provides detailed instructions for programming individual Memory
Blocks. The Memory Blocks are listed numerically. For each Memory Block, the
following information is provided.
 General Description provides a brief explanation of the function of the
Memory Block.
 Display represents the default information displayed in the Multiline
Terminal LCD during programming.
 Settings (when applicable) provides the information that is entered using
the line keys on the Multiline Terminal.
 Programming Procedures provides detailed procedures for
programming the Memory Block.

Related Programming (where applicable) provides a list of associated
Memory Blocks that may need to be programmed.
 Notes provides additional information related to programming the Memory
Block.
